The Brunswick Hotel in Faribault, MN (originally known as the Barron House) was a prominent Victorian-era lodging and dining establishment located on the 100 block of Central Avenue. In November 1911, under the management of J.W. Schultz, the hotel operated as the town's premier community gathering hub, hosting holiday dinners and Thanksgiving events for travelers and locals.
